Personalized Bandwidth Management
Traditional streaming services allocate a fixed bitrate based on your subscription tier. In contrast, AI‑enhanced players monitor your network in real time, adjusting resolution in 0.5‑second intervals. During a recent 4K movie night on a congested home Wi‑Fi, the AI dropped the stream from 25 Mbps to 12 Mbps for a single scene, then ramped back up without a visible glitch. My buffering incidents fell from an average of 3 per hour to less than one, saving me roughly 15 minutes of frustration each session.

Dynamic Content Creation
Beyond recommendations, AI now assists creators in real time. I experimented with a live‑streaming tool that auto‑generates subtitles in six languages, synchronizing them within 200 ms of speech. The same tool also suggests background music that matches the emotional tone of the scene, pulling from a licensed library of 4,000 tracks. For a 30‑minute cooking stream, the AI swapped out a bland instrumental for a lively jazz piece after detecting a shift from prep to plating, keeping viewers engaged longer.
Monetization and Advertising Shifts
Advertisers used to buy fixed slots, hoping a broad audience would see their message. AI now inserts micro‑ads that align with a viewer’s interests and viewing context. In a trial, I watched a sci‑fi series and received a 15‑second ad for a VR headset precisely when the plot introduced a futuristic gadget. The click‑through rate for that ad was 3.2 % versus the 0.8 % average for generic placements. While this precision boosts revenue, it also raises privacy concerns for users who dislike being profiled.

Challenges and Who Might Be Left Behind
The biggest limitation is the data requirement. Users on limited mobile plans see fewer AI benefits because the system throttles analysis to conserve bandwidth. In my own test, a 3G connection reduced personalized suggestions by 40 % and forced the stream to stay at 720p even for short clips. Moreover, older smart TVs lacking sufficient processing power cannot run on‑device AI, forcing them to rely on slower cloud inference that adds 1–2 seconds of latency.
